Received a call from our NICU.  Mom had loss of power to fridge and freezer for about 13 hours.  She has a baby in the NICU and wondering if milk is okay to use.  I said milk in the deep freeze was fine since that wasn't opened and that would stay frozen longer than that.  But, wondering about the 6 bottles in the fridge?  Normally I would be pretty relaxed about a full-term healthy baby and milk storage, but am thinking that we can't just use the smell test with this NICU baby.

Any thoughts?
